What will I learn?
Master the essentials of X-ray diffraction with a focused course that takes you from sample preparation and instrument setup to peak indexing, lattice parameter refinement, and phase identification using major databases. Learn to avoid common artifacts, optimize scan parameters, and connect diffraction patterns to microstructure, residual stress, and mechanical behavior for reliable, publication-ready results.

Develop skills
- Design robust XRD experiments: choose scan modes, optics, and key parameters fast.
- Prepare high-quality powder samples: control texture, thickness, and surface strain.
- Index peaks and refine lattices: apply DICVOL, least-squares, and Rietveld basics.
- Identify alloy phases quickly: use PDF-4, COD, and pattern-matching workflows.
- Link XRD to mechanics: extract stress, size, and microstrain to explain properties.
